From IT to Top Rank: Pune’s Archit Parag Dongre Clinches AIR 3 in UPSC CSE 2024 on His Second Attempt

Archit Parag Dongre, a civil services aspirant from Pune, has made waves by securing All India Rank (AIR) 3 in the Union Public Service Commission (UPSC) Civil Services Examination (CSE) 2024. This remarkable achievement marks his second attempt after he had previously secured AIR 153 in the 2023 examination.

Dongre, who hails from Pune, had pursued his B.Tech in Electrical and Electronics Engineering from Vellore Institute of Technology (VIT), Vellore. Although he initially worked in an IT company for a year, he decided to quit his job to focus on his UPSC preparation. His decision to choose Philosophy as his optional subject paid off as he improved his rank dramatically in his second attempt.

Reflecting on his journey, Dongre expressed that his success was the result of persistent effort, self-belief, and the support of his family. He spent countless hours studying and honing his skills, balancing both theoretical knowledge and practical application. He also credited his coaching sessions and peer group support for guiding him through the complex preparation process.

UPSC CSE, regarded as one of the toughest examinations in India, tests candidates on a wide range of subjects, including general knowledge, current affairs, and an optional subject of the candidate’s choice. The exam sees participation from lakhs of aspirants every year, and the intense competition requires an unwavering commitment and dedication.

This year, a total of 1,009 candidates cleared the UPSC CSE, with Shakti Dubey securing the top rank and Harshita Goyal in second place. However, Dongre’s achievement is especially noteworthy as he is recognized as the highest-ranking candidate from Maharashtra in 2024.

Pune continues to be a leading hub for civil services aspirants, with numerous coaching institutes and libraries supporting thousands of students aiming for success in the UPSC exams. Archit’s story is a beacon of hope and motivation for future aspirants in Pune and beyond.
